can be written
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"can be written"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to indicate that something is possible to express or document in written form. Example: "The equation can be written in several different formats depending on the context."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
When using "can be written", ensure the context clearly indicates what is being written and the intended audience. Specify the format or style if relevant.
Common error
Avoid using "can be written" without specifying what 'it' refers to. For example, instead of "It can be written", specify "The report can be written" or "The equation can be written".

Linguistic Context
The phrase "can be written" functions as a passive construction indicating possibility or permissibility. It expresses that something has the potential to be expressed or documented in written form. As Ludwig AI indicates, the phrase is considered grammatically correct and widely usable.

FAQs
How do I use "can be written" in a sentence?
Use "can be written" to indicate that something is expressible or documentable in written form. For example, "This equation "can be written" in multiple ways".
What are some alternatives to "can be written"?
Alternatives include phrases like "may be expressed", "could be documented", or "might be formulated", depending on the specific nuance you want to convey.
Is it correct to say "can be wrote" instead of "can be written"?
No, "can be wrote" is grammatically incorrect. The correct passive form is ""can be written"", using the past participle of 'write'.
What's the difference between "can be written" and "must be written"?
"Can be written" indicates possibility or permissibility, while "must be written" indicates necessity or obligation. For example, "The instructions "can be written" in any language" vs. "The contract "must be written" in English".
